No doubt your car is strong but with a 5.4 DOHC, that is no surprise. I like the concept and know of another guy who has done the same thing at the Corral. Anyway, I've seen what Cobras with 4.30's and even better gears will do so don't preach to me about 4.10's. The percentage difference between them and 3.73's is not enough of a big deal. 4.30's or even 4.88's are more attractive imho.

And sure the other Cobra might have been weaker than mine but I destroyed him and so far any other Cobra I've come across. My car has always been a relative ringer from what I have seen. before my valvestem seals went, I did make 301 at the wheels but my car isn't the same car it was in 98, that's for sure. I have yet to run a Cobra with any internal engine mods but would understand the loss when that happens. I even expect to lose eventually, That's only natural. I would bet any amount of money that I would beat any Cobra with the same or close to same rwhp as my car and 4.10's in this kind of race. Even if my car had your 400rwhp as well, I would beat your car at the end of a highway race. I've seen it too many times to argue differently. If the race began around 60, I could stay in 3rd gear longer(while the 4.10 cobra would have to go to 4rth )and then be able to run out 4rth gear longer too than him too. If I haven't passed the hypothetical Cobra in 3rd gear, I will eventually pass in 4rth because the 4.10 Cobra would have to shift to 5th earlier than I would. Yes, 4.10's definitely pull harder in 5th than my crappy 3.73's but they are no contest between my 1.00 ratio 4rth gear and 3.73's compared to a .63 5th gear driven 4.10. I don't care what gear someone has back there. Anyway, yeah, races from rolls suck but I live in an area with few stoplights so I take the races where I can find them. So understand, I know better gears are faster for the 1/4 it is just in this type of race that I prefer the weak 3.73's.
